About the Role
We are seeking a highly skilled Technical Sales Representative to join our team in Pretoria. As a key member of our sales team, you will be responsible for identifying and securing new clients within the agricultural, seed, and crop protection sectors. Your technical expertise and excellent communication skills will enable you to build strong relationships with customers and present our services clearly to both scientific and non-scientific stakeholders.
Key Responsibilities
- Identify and target new clients within the agricultural, seed, and crop protection sectors
- Build and manage strong customer relationships from initial engagement through to repeat contracts
- Present and communicate technical services clearly to both scientific and non-scientific stakeholders
- Understand customer challenges and translate them into tailored service proposals
- Work closely with our internal laboratory and trial teams to ensure smooth service delivery and high client satisfaction
- Maintain a healthy sales pipeline and meet monthly and quarterly revenue targets
- Attend industry events, trade shows, and client sites as required
- Prepare quotes, proposals, and technical sales documentation
- Track sales activities and report performance to management
Requirements
- Proven experience in technical sales (preferably in Agri, seed, lab services, or crop protection sectors)
- Qualification or prior accreditation as a Seed Sampler would be desirable
- Experience selling services into seed companies, breeding programs, or agrochemical/biological product developers is advantageous
- Strong understanding of at least one of the following: seed testing, plant breeding, molecular biology, GLP trials, agronomy, or crop inputs
- Knowledge of GLP compliance, trial design, and regulatory requirements is advantageous
Qualifications
- Degree or diploma in Agriculture, Plant Science, Biological Sciences, Agronomy or similar
- Seed Sampler qualification (optional)

About Sales Jobs in Tshwane
In Tshwane, South Africa, the sales profession is an in-demand field across various industries. Typically, sales professionals in this region work in fast-paced environments, where they must possess strong communication and interpersonal skills to effectively engage with clients and close deals. Generally, a career in sales can be rewarding, offering opportunities for growth, development, and financial rewards.
The typical salary range for sales positions in Tshwane is broad and varies depending on factors such as experience, company size, industry sector, and performance. Broadly speaking, entry-level sales roles typically offer salary ranges between R200 000 to R400 000 per annum, while experienced sales professionals can earn salaries ranging from R500 000 to R1 million or more per year, depending on individual performance and the specific industry sector.
Common skills required for a successful career in sales include excellent communication and interpersonal skills, the ability to build rapport with clients, and strong negotiation and problem-solving abilities. Additionally, knowledge of market trends, product information, and industry dynamics is often essential. Other valuable skills include strategic thinking, adaptability, and the ability to work independently and as part of a team.
Sales roles are commonly found in various industries, including financial services sector, technology industry, manufacturing sector, and retail. In these sectors, sales professionals play a critical role in driving business growth, identifying new opportunities, and developing customer relationships.
For those interested in pursuing a career in sales, there are typically several career progression paths available. Typically, entry-level sales roles provide an opportunity to develop skills and gain experience before moving into more senior roles, such as team leader or account manager. With experience and additional training, sales professionals can progress to specialist roles, such as business development manager or sales director.
